Who may be able to join
- Adults between 18 and 65 years old, of any gender.
- People who have been diagnosed with multiple sclerosis (MS) based on a specific set of diagnostic guidelines called the 2017 revised McDonald criteria.
- People who have been on a stable MS treatment (known as disease-modifying therapy) before joining the trial.
- People whose level of physical disability, measured by a standard MS scoring tool called the EDSS, falls between 1.0 and 5.5 at the time of screening.
- People who are able and willing to follow all study procedures, attend follow-up visits, and take the study medication as required.
- People who are able to provide written consent before any study-related procedures begin.
- Female participants who are not currently pregnant or breastfeeding, or, if there is a possibility of becoming pregnant, those who agree to use effective birth control throughout the study.
Who may not be able to join
Each point below is a reason the trial team may not be able to accept someone. It is not a list of requirements to meet.
- People who have a known allergy or sensitivity to taurine or any of its ingredients.
- Women who are currently pregnant or breastfeeding.
- People who are already taking part in another clinical trial.
- People who decline to participate in this clinical study.
